titleOfInvention Device for repeated semi-invasive abrasion of lesions on the walls of hollow organs
abstract A device is for repeated semi-invasive abrasion of lesions on the walls of hollow organs, in particular blood vessels or the gastrointestinal tract of a patient. The device includes an outer stent which, fixed in position at the site of the lesions, can be clamped against the wall of the hollow organ and has recesses through which the lesions can inwardly protrude. The device further includes a cutting body which is guided within the outer stent and only negligibly narrows the internal bore of the outer stent, which cutting body has cutting edges sliding on the inner side of the outer stent and is coupled magnetically to an external magnet system via which it can turn about the stent axis and/or can move longitudinally along the stent axis.
